The best Side of what is md5's application
The best Side of what is md5's application
Blog Article
All we really have to do is transfer Every single bit seven Areas for the still left. We will get it done by having an intermediate phase to make it simpler to see what is happening:
MD5 (Concept-Digest Algorithm five) is usually a cryptographic hash perform that generates a 128-bit hash price. It was as soon as broadly useful for data integrity verification and password hashing but is now regarded insecure as a consequence of vulnerabilities like collision attacks.
Deterministic: A similar enter will always generate a similar hash, enabling for regularity in hashing operations.
A cryptographic strategy for verifying the authenticity and integrity of digital messages or files. MD5 was when Employed in digital signatures.
MD5 will not include the use of salt (random info coupled with the password before hashing), which makes it less safe for password storage. Devoid of salt, identical passwords will often make a similar hash, making it less difficult for attackers to establish common passwords.
Pre-Picture Resistance: MD5 is not really resistant to pre-impression assaults (the chance to obtain an enter corresponding to a supplied hash) when compared to far more fashionable hashing algorithms.
The birthday attack exploits the birthday paradox to search check here out collisions in hash functions far more competently. MD5’s 128-bit size can make it vulnerable to these kinds of assaults, as the odds of locating a collision raise significantly as a lot more hashes are produced.
Checksum Verification in Non-Essential Applications: In a few non-important applications, MD5 is utilized to verify the integrity of information through transmission or downloads. Having said that, it’s vital that you Notice that this is simply not proposed for delicate or high-value knowledge.
Modular arithmetic is made use of once more, this time incorporating the last result to the consistent, which is K2. K2 is e8c7b756 In line with our list of K values within the The operations part.
MD5 is also prone to pre-image assaults, the place an attacker can find an input that creates a selected hash price. Put simply, presented an MD5 hash, it’s computationally possible for an attacker to reverse-engineer and uncover an input that matches that hash.
These algorithms incorporate constructed-in functions like salting, essential stretching, and adjustable problem things that add additional layers of safety on the password hashing course of action.
Variety “add(a,b)” into the sphere in which it says “Calculation equation”. This basically tells the calculator to add the figures we have typed in for the and B. This offers us a result of:
Malware Evaluation: In malware analysis, MD5 hashes were being accustomed to recognize recognized malware variants. By evaluating the MD5 hash of the suspicious file using a database of regarded malicious hashes, analysts could quickly flag opportunity threats.
Following the audit report has actually been received, Will probably be reviewed, and when it is determined to get suitable, It will likely be sent on to further more stages.